Arrest warrant against Swami Agnivesh
Tribune News Service
Hisar, July 21
Judicial Magistrate Ashwani Kumar Mehta of Hansi, near here, today issued an arrest warrant against Swami Agnivesh, noted social activist and Civil Society leader.
The warrant was issued in a case filed against him by a resident of Hansi, Parveen Tayal, who had alleged in his application on May 19 that the Swami had hurt the feelings of the Hindu community by his remarks on the Amarnath Yatra.
Accepting his plea, the court had directed the police to register a case and ask Swami Agnivesh to join investigation. However, he failed to appear despite the summons. Instead, he sent his lawyer to represent him.
In todayââ¬â¢s hearing, the police pleaded that the Swami was avoiding joining investigations. The Swamiââ¬â¢s lawyer sought three weeksââ¬â¢ time to do so in view of his clientââ¬â¢s busy schedule.
The request was denied and the court accepted the police plea for issuance of an arrest warrant.
The next date of hearing has been fixed as August 29. http://www.tribuneindia.com/2011/20110722/haryana.htm#3
